WireGuard is a novel VPN that runs inside the Linux Kernel and uses state-of-the-art cryptography (the "Noise" protocol). It aims to be faster, simpler, leaner, and more useful than IPSec, while avoiding the massive headache. It intends to be considerably more performant than OpenVPN. WireGuard is designed as a general purpose VPN for running on embedded interfaces and super computers alike, fit for many different circumstances. It runs over UDP.
This metapackage explicitly depends on both the kernel module and the userspace tooling. If this metapackage is installed, and wireguard is already in use on the system, the kernel module will be reloaded when the module is upgraded.
This metapackage explicitly depends on both the kernel module and the userspace tooling. If this metapackage is installed, and wireguard is already in use on the system, the kernel module will be reloaded when the module is upgraded.
Original maintainer | Daniel Kahn Gillmor |
---|---|
Homepage | https://www.wireguard.com |
1.0.20200319

1.0.20200206


0.0.20200215

0.0.20190913

Distribution | Version | Since | Package | Installed | Packager | |
---|---|---|---|---|---|---|
![]() | deb | 1.0.20200206-2~bpo10+1 | 2020-03-09 | 7.23 kiB | 15 kiB | Daniel Kahn Gillmor |
![]() | rpm | 0.0.20200215-2.2 | 2020-03-22 | 65.3 kiB | 18 kiB | https://bugs.opensuse.org |
![]() | deb | 0.0.20190913-1ubuntu1 | 2019-09-27 | 4.64 kiB | 38 kiB | Ubuntu Developers |
![]() | deb | 1.0.20200206-1ubuntu1~19.10.1 | 2020-02-20 | 2.89 kiB | 15 kiB | Ubuntu Developers |
![]() | deb | 1.0.20200319-1ubuntu1 | 2020-03-22 | 2.84 kiB | 16 kiB | Ubuntu Developers |
Latest updates

OpenSUSE Tumbleweed oss: Updated from 0.0.20200215-2.1 to 0.0.20200215-2.2
2020-03-22
- Fix build on openSUSE 15.2
- wireguard-fix-leap152.patch

Ubuntu 20.04 focal/universe: Updated from 1.0.20200206-2ubuntu1 to 1.0.20200319-1ubuntu1
2020-03-22

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200319-1ubuntu1 removed
2020-03-22

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200319-1ubuntu1 introduced
2020-03-22

Debian 10.0 buster-backports/main: Version 1.0.20200206-2~bpo10+1 introduced
2020-03-09
- Rebuild for buster-backports.
- prepare Vcs for buster-backports

OpenSUSE Tumbleweed oss: Updated from 0.0.20200215-1.2 to 0.0.20200215-2.1
2020-03-08
- Fix build on openSUSE 15.2
- wireguard-fix-leap152.patch

OpenSUSE Tumbleweed oss: Updated from 0.0.20200214-1.3 to 0.0.20200215-1.2
2020-02-29
- Update to version 0.0.20200215
- send: cleanup skb padding calculation
- socket: remove useless synchronize_net

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200206-2ubuntu1 removed
2020-02-26

Ubuntu 20.04 focal/universe: Updated from 1.0.20200206-1ubuntu1 to 1.0.20200206-2ubuntu1
2020-02-26

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200206-2ubuntu1 introduced
2020-02-26

OpenSUSE Tumbleweed oss: Updated from 0.0.20200214-1.2 to 0.0.20200214-1.3
2020-02-26
- Update to version 0.0.20200214
- chacha20poly1305: defensively protect against large inputs
- netns: ensure that icmp src address is correct with nat
- receive: reset last_under_load to zero
- send: account for mtu=0 devices

Ubuntu 19.10 eoan-proposed/universe: Version 1.0.20200206-1ubuntu1~19.10.1 removed
2020-02-24

Ubuntu 19.10 eoan-updates/universe: Version 1.0.20200206-1ubuntu1~19.10.1 introduced
2020-02-20

OpenSUSE Tumbleweed oss: Updated from 0.0.20200205-1.3 to 0.0.20200214-1.2
2020-02-20
- Update to version 0.0.20200214
- chacha20poly1305: defensively protect against large inputs
- netns: ensure that icmp src address is correct with nat
- receive: reset last_under_load to zero
- send: account for mtu=0 devices

Ubuntu 19.10 eoan-proposed/universe: Version 1.0.20200206-1ubuntu1~19.10.1 introduced
2020-02-19

OpenSUSE Tumbleweed oss: Updated from 0.0.20200205-1.2 to 0.0.20200205-1.3
2020-02-16
- Update to version 0.0.20200205
- allowedips: remove previously added list item when OOM fail
- noise: reject peers with low order public keys
- netns: ensure non-addition of peers with failed precomputation
- netns: tie socket waiting to target pid

OpenSUSE Tumbleweed oss: Updated from 0.0.20200128-1.3 to 0.0.20200205-1.2
2020-02-09
- Update to version 0.0.20200205
- allowedips: remove previously added list item when OOM fail
- noise: reject peers with low order public keys
- netns: ensure non-addition of peers with failed precomputation
- netns: tie socket waiting to target pid

Ubuntu 20.04 focal/universe: Updated from 1.0.20200121-2ubuntu1 to 1.0.20200206-1ubuntu1
2020-02-09

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200206-1ubuntu1 removed
2020-02-09

Ubuntu 20.04 focal-proposed/universe: Version 1.0.20200206-1ubuntu1 introduced
2020-02-08
Related packages
wireguard-arch - Wireguard module for Arch Kernel
wireguard-debugsource - Debug sources for package wireguard
wireguard-dkms - next generation secure network tunnel - module sources
wireguard-kmp-default - Fast, modern, secure kernel VPN tunnel
wireguard-kmp-default-debuginfo - Debug information for package wireguard-kmp-default
wireguard-lts - Wireguard module for LTS Kernel
wireguard-tools - next generation secure network tunnel - tools for configuration
wireguard-tools-debuginfo - Debug information for package wireguard-tools
wireguard-tools-debugsource - Debug sources for package wireguard-tools